if it was steady at 1A4 ....... something else is wrong
silly mistakes are possible even when you have zillion years of experience - maybe you had something critical in heat transfer and isolation arrangement
as I wrote - I had problems with second channel during T-Bed assembly ; first channel was sorted completely , every part position checked and finalized , even THD measurements completed ....... then , with second channel I couldn't bias it
I already had thoughts that pcb is having some mistake ( L and R aren't the same , logically) , when I realised that I mounted pair of IRFP240 , instead of IRFP240+IRFP9240
Silly ZM

I removed the Output Mosfets and powered up the board. With P1 setting of 0E, the voltage at the junction of R15, R16, R17 measures 1.246 Volts. I turned up P1 slowly and the junction voltage increases smoothly. I measured upto 1.275 Volts and stopped. Even without the Output Mosfets, offset can be set to zero.
So I am sure that I wasn't patient with Iq setting. Thermal Transfer issues didn't seem to exist, which I checked before dismantling the output stage from the heat sink.
What should the minimum voltage be at the junction of R15, 16, 17?

A quick update. Yes, as ZenMod had suspected, mine was indeed a thermal arrangement issue. Metal surface of the Mosfet was not in proper contact with the heatsink.
Fixed fresh pair of Mosfets. Now all is well.
Minimum Iq is 1.05Amps. It won't get any lower. It depends on Vgs of the devices. Offset can be nulled very smoothly.
But the build up to set Iq, takes a little more than a minute and during this time, offset begins from above 10 volts before settling down to zero. One reason for this is also because the regulated supply I am using, ramps up slowly, after power on.
Don't those of you who have built the M25 experience a turn-off, turn-off thump. Delay, Speaker protection?

Whoops, I mis spoke...I have them for J2 clone...
My bad
Russellc
in that case - it's clearer ...... you have enhanced mode parts (SJEP) , while for any iteration of SIT-3 you need depletion mode part (which would be SJDP)
what final result would be , dunno ....... but - that's easy to try in SissySIT circuit , if one is having depletion mode Semisouths ...... which I don't have
